一种文件属性的设置方法以及装置制造方法及图纸

技术编号:43655831 阅读:18 留言:0更新日期:2024-12-13 12:48
本申请公开了一种文件属性的设置方法,用于提升网络附属存储NAS服务器的文件属性设置效率。本申请实施例方法包括:网络附属存储NAS服务器接收客户端发送的属性设置请求,属性设置请求用于指示目标目录和目标属性,目标目录下包括多个对象,对象是文件或者子目录。NAS服务器对目标目录下的多个对象按照目标属性进行属性设置,目标属性包括以下一项或多项:所有者属性、只读属性、隐藏属性、时间属性和权限属性。NAS服务器向客户端发送属性设置请求的响应消息。

【技术实现步骤摘要】

本申请涉及计算机领域,尤其涉及一种文件属性的设置方法以及装置


技术介绍

1、随着互联网技术的发展,网络文件系统(network file system,nfs)在分布式计算、云存储和数据共享等方面发挥了重要作用。网络文件系统是一种用于共享文件和文件系统的网络协议,允许在不同主机之间共享文件和目录。

2、在网络文件系统中,用户可以通过客户端设置网络附加存储(network attachedstorage,nas)服务器中的目录和文件的属性。目前用户通过客户端设置网络附加存储服务器中目录和文件的属性的时,需要对网络附加存储服务器中目录和文件单独进行属性设置操作,即客户端需要先对要设置的目录或文件进行查询操作,之后再对查询的文件或目录进行属性设置。

3、因此,目前当用户需要对网络附加存储服务器中大量的目录或文件进行属性设置时,用户需要通过客户端发送大量的查询请求和属性设置请求,导致网络附加存储服务器的属性设置效率低,同时大量的属性设置请求造成大量的网络资源的消耗。


技术实现思路p>

1、本申请本文档来自技高网...

【技术保护点】

1.一种文件属性的设置方法,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,所述方法还包括:

3.根据权利要求1或2所述的方法,其特征在于,所述属性设置请求的设置方式为同步设置,所述方法还包括:

4.根据权利要求1或2所述的方法,其特征在于,所述属性设置请求的设置方式为同步设置,所述方法还包括:

5.根据权利要求1至4中任一项所述的方法,其特征在于,所述属性设置请求的设置方式为同步设置,当所述NAS服务器在设置时间内未完成对所述目标目录下多个对象的属性设置时,所述方法还包括:

6.根据权利要求1或2所述的方法,其特...

【技术特征摘要】

1.一种文件属性的设置方法,其特征在于,包括:

2.根据权利要求1所述的方法,其特征在于,所述方法还包括:

3.根据权利要求1或2所述的方法,其特征在于,所述属性设置请求的设置方式为同步设置,所述方法还包括:

4.根据权利要求1或2所述的方法,其特征在于,所述属性设置请求的设置方式为同步设置,所述方法还包括:

5.根据权利要求1至4中任一项所述的方法,其特征在于,所述属性设置请求的设置方式为同步设置,当所述nas服务器在设置时间内未完成对所述目标目录下多个对象的属性设置时,所述方法还包括:

6.根据权利要求1或2所述的方法,其特征在于,所述属性设置请求的设置方式为异步设置,所述响应消息用于向所述客户端指示属性设置异常。

7.根据权利要求1、2和6中任一项所述的方法,其特征在于,所述属性设置请求的设置方式为异步设置,所述方法还包括:

8.根据权利要求1至7中任一项所述的方法,其特征在于,所述方法还包括:

9.根据权利要求1至8中任一项所述的方法,其特征在于,所述权限属性包括以下一项或多项:读取权限、写入权限、删除权限、修改权限和完全控制权限。

10.根据权利要求1至9中任一项所述的方法,其特征在于,所述方法还包括:

11.一种文件属性的设置装置,其特征在于,包括:

12.根据权利要求11所述的装置,其特征在于,所述处理单元还用于:

13.根据权利要求11或12所述的装置,其特征在于,所述属性设置请求的设置方式为同步设置,当所述nas服务器在设置时间内完成对所述目标目录下多个对象的属性设置,则所述响应消息用于向所述客户端指示属性设置完成。

14.根据权利要求11或12所述的装置,其特征在于,所述属性设置请求的设置方式为同步设置,当所述nas服务器在设置时间内未完成对所...

【专利技术属性】
技术研发人员:张明谦杨静
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1